Original Description
Under the dappled shade of a riverside tree, Deux Baigneuses Nues Sous Un Arbre Au Bord De L'eau by Aristide Maillol captures an eternal moment of serene intimacy. Painted in 1899 during Maillol's transition from tapestry to sculpture, this oil work embodies his lifelong pursuit of classical harmony through simplified, volumetric forms. The two bathers—their voluptuous bodies rendered in warm, earthy tones—recline in a dreamlike landscape where sunlight filters through foliage, dissolving into impressionistic brushstrokes. Though lesser-known than his later bronze sculptures, this early masterpiece reveals Maillol’s dialogue with Post-Impressionism and foreshadows his Neo-Classical legacy: a bridge between Rodin's dynamism and the modernist purity of form championed by Brancusi. Its quiet lyricism places it among the most poetic nudes of early 20th-century art, celebrating femininity as both earthly and timeless.
